... For Doors Open Ottawa. One of the first things they said is that the TSB is an independent accident investigation body. (i.e.: They are not TC)
It was pretty cool how much they can learn about the state of the airplane prior to an accident, from the airspeed needle leaving a mark on the dial at impact, to the deformation in an annunciator light bulb that would suggest whether or not a warning light was on at the time of the accident. Plus they have a serious collection of black boxes. It's interesting how they can read the story the airplane is telling, even if there's no person left who can.
We had look at signs of molten turbine blades being shot through a helo engine, a materials lab to study fatigue and fracture, a scanning electron microscope, recovering data from destroyed GPSs, the black box data extraction lab, and the math of photogrammetry (e.g.: Locating a camera in space based on the picture it took)
